Alpana Ram is a scholar working on Pharmaceutical Science, Molecular Biology and Dermatology. According to data from OpenAlex, Alpana Ram has authored 41 papers receiving a total of 753 indexed citations (citations by other indexed papers that have themselves been cited), including 24 papers in Pharmaceutical Science, 10 papers in Molecular Biology and 6 papers in Dermatology. Recurrent topics in Alpana Ram's work include Advanced Drug Delivery Systems (16 papers), Advancements in Transdermal Drug Delivery (14 papers) and Drug Solubulity and Delivery Systems (8 papers). Alpana Ram is often cited by papers focused on Advanced Drug Delivery Systems (16 papers), Advancements in Transdermal Drug Delivery (14 papers) and Drug Solubulity and Delivery Systems (8 papers). Alpana Ram collaborates with scholars based in India, Israel and Finland. Alpana Ram's co-authors include Surendra H. Bodakhe, Rajeev Gupta, Abraham Weizman, Anat Biegon, Leon Karp, Pradeep Kumar, N. K. Jain, Ankur Kaul, Anil K. Mishra and D. Majumder and has published in prestigious journals such as Biochemical and Biophysical Research Communications, Journal of Ethnopharmacology and Life Sciences.
